Workshop on Practical Wear Problem-Solving

This special session is designed to be an interactive workshop on wear problem-solving. Invited panelists with over a century and a half of combined experience in the wear of materials will field questions and provide illustrations of wear diagnosis and material selection. Interested WOM 2009 conference attendees are encouraged to bring current wear problems to present to the panel for discussion.
